Created attachment 55941 [details] Screenshot: 'text_language_none.png' The selected text language is 'None' [= no spellcheck]. See the attached screenshot 'text_language_none.png'. You can select a text language [e.g.: English (USA)] via - 'Tools > Language > For Selection.../For Paragraph.../For all Text...', or - mouse click on '[None]' in the Status Bar.
